Q: What materials are commonly used in hospital beds? A: Hospital beds are usually constructed from strong steel or aluminum frames with protective coatings that resist corrosion and ensure long-term durability. Q: How does a hospital bed improve patient comfort? A: A hospital bed allows adjustment of height, head, and leg positions, helping patients find comfortable postures for rest, meals, and recovery. Q: What safety features are included in hospital beds? A: Hospital beds are equipped with side rails, locking wheels, and stable structures to ensure patient protection during care. Q: How does an electric hospital bed function? A: An electric hospital bed uses motorized controls to adjust the bed’s height and sections, providing convenience for both patients and caregivers. Q: Why is mobility important for hospital beds? A: Mobility enables easy movement of patients between rooms or wards, improving workflow and accessibility for medical staff.
